= EGR Theory. EGR serves one purpose and one purpose only. That purpose is to reduce Oxides of Nitrogen (NOx). Undernormal combustion, Nitrogen(N2)Oxygen (O2) in the air and Hydrocarbons (HC) in the fuel combind into water(H2O) Carbon dioxide (CO2) and the Nitrogen remains unchanged. Under very hot combustion temperatures, the Nitrogen reacts with the other two byproducts and forms Nitrogen oxide (NO). After being released into the atmosphere, it picks up another Oxygen and becomes Nitrogen dioxide (NO2). In the presence of sunlight,
it combines with other compounds like Hydrocarbons and forms Smog. Since exhaust gas is inert (very stable) it doesn't burn again. So by being introduced into
the combustion chamber, it will lower combustion chamber temps enough so that
the Nitrogen doesn't react with the other compounds and is passed unchanged out
the tailpipe thus not contributing to smog. Now, since exhaust gas doesn't burn, it
doesn't exactly help with combustion. At higher RPM's, this really isn't noticable,
but at idle, the reintroduction of exhaust gas will cause a very rough idle and can
cause stalling if to much is introduced into the combustion chamber = = EGR Valve = 4.2L, 4.6L, 5.4L and 6.8L Engines 1. Disconnect the negative battery cable. 2. Remove the vacuum hose from the EGR valve. 3. On the 4.6L engine, remove the nut and brake booster bracket. 4. On the 5.4L engine, remove the DPFE sensor retaining nuts and place the sensor to the side to allow access to the EGR tube. 5. Disconnect the EGR valve-to-exhaust manifold tube from the EGR valve. 6. Remove the EGR valve mounting bolts, then separate the valve from the intake manifold. 7. Remove and discard the old EGR valve gasket, and clean the gasket mating surfaces on the valve and the intake manifold. To Install: 8. Install the EGR valve, along with a new gasket, on the manifold, then install and tighten the mounting bolts. 9. Connect the EGR valve-to-exhaust manifold tube to the valve, then tighten the tube nut to 25-35 lbs. (34-47 Nm). 10. Connect the vacuum hose to the EGR valve. 11. On the 5.7L engine, install the DPFE sensor. 12. On the 4.6L engine install the brake booster bracket and the retaining nut. 13. Connect the negative battery cable.
